When people say: “Oh, they should’ve played up how Starlight was a piece of shit for laughs.” That… kinda would’ve killed what I liked about Starlight, I think. To me, almost all of her episodes are already about how she’s a mess of a person. Episodes like On The Road to Friendship, or Uncommon Bond. They aren’t funny to me. They paint the picture of a character who’s kind of a catastrophe even though she genuinely wants to be better.
Her explosion at Trixie in A Horse Shoe-in is also not funny. I think it’s a genuinely well written and emotionally harrowing. One of my top 5 favourite scenes in all of season 9 probably. I don’t think Starlight is a funny character, and at her best I think that’s what works best about her. The emotions I associate with her episodes are depression, worry, and melancholy.
